What is a Product Manager at Adyen?
The Product Manager role at Adyen is pivotal in shaping the future of financial technology. As a Product Manager, you will be at the forefront of delivering innovative solutions that enhance customer experiences across various platforms. Your decisions will impact not only the products themselves but also how users interact with them and the overall success of the business. You will collaborate with cross-functional teams to drive product strategy, development, and execution, ensuring that Adyen remains a leader in the payments industry.
This role is particularly exciting due to the complexity and scale of the products you'll manage. You will work on various aspects of payment solutions, from optimizing checkout processes to leveraging artificial intelligence for fraud detection and prevention. Your strategic influence will be essential in aligning product offerings with customer needs and market demands, making your contributions vital to the company's ongoing growth.

Preparation for your interviews should focus on understanding Adyen's values, the skills required for the role, and the nature of product management within the company.
Role-related knowledge – You should have a solid grasp of payment systems, user experience design, and data analytics. Interviewers will look for your ability to relate your previous experiences to the challenges faced at Adyen.
Problem-solving ability – Expect to demonstrate how you approach complex problems and frame your thought processes. Use the STAR (Situation, Task, Action, Result) method to articulate your responses clearly.
Leadership – Show how you can influence and motivate cross-functional teams. Your ability to communicate effectively and build relationships will be crucial.
Culture fit / values – Adyen values collaboration, innovation, and customer-centricity. You'll need to convey how your personal values align with these principles.
Interview Process Overview
The interview process at Adyen tends to be structured and thorough, reflecting the company's commitment to finding the right fit for both candidates and teams. Typically, candidates can expect multiple rounds of interviews, starting with an initial screening followed by deeper dives into technical skills, problem-solving capabilities, and cultural fit.
Throughout the process, interviewers will focus on assessing your experiences and how they align with Adyen's mission. Expect to engage with various team members, including product leads and cross-functional partners. This collaborative approach is designed to ensure that candidates not only possess the technical skills required but also fit well within the company's culture.
